After the Eid-ul-Fitr vacations, the Pakistan Stock Exchange (PSX) saw a robust upward trend on Tuesday.
The market opened with remarkable gains on the first trading day following the holiday, with the KSE-100 Index surging by over 4,400 points.
The index jumped 1,568 points to 154,309 points at the opening of trading on Tuesday. The KSE-100 Index then increased by an additional 4,449 points to reach 157,190 points.
Economic experts claim that even though the PSX continues to fluctuate, the general direction of the market is still upward and good.
